XP Start Menu or Classic Windows? |
|||
|
Right Click the Start Button and choose Properties. Choose Classic Start Menu for old time Windows 95/98/ME menu style. To customize either further, choose Customize. On the Classic Start Menu, you have the following options:
Clicking Advanced will allow you to move, add, and delete Start Menu items through Explorer.
XP Default Start Menu Choosing the XP Start Menu then Customize, will bring up items such as icon size, the number of programs to put on the start menu and your default Internet Browser, and E-Mail client. Choosing the Advanced Tab bring up a whole bunch of neat options:
Regardless of which you prefer, it is nice to have certain abilities like turning off the notification of newly installed programs. (like we forgot we installed it! ;) )
